I don't think any of them have particularly good battery life. WiFi, especially, eats up power the same way talk time on a cell phone does, and for the same reason: you're powering up a radio transmitter. It sucks, but...

Backlit color displays eat power, too. The old black-and-white palms were limited, but they had terrific battery life. It's a trade-off, I'm afraid.
